THE 2012 OYSTER RIVER FESTIVAL IS SCHEDULED FOR SATURDAY MAY 12th, 11am-1:30pm!



Festival Vision: The Oyster River Festival is an annual event held in the heart of Durham, New Hampshire, offering live music, arts and crafts, children's activities and more! The Festival strengthens the relationship between Oyster River students and alumni, the University of New Hampshire, and the wider Durham/Seacoast community by encouraging everyone who has made their home in the Durham area to come together to commemorate the people and place that makes Durham a distinct and special community. Under the auspices of the Oyster River Alumni Association, the Festival also serves as a fundraiser that benefits students in the Oyster River School District through a variety of grants and scholarships.
